*** tpb has joined #freeorion | 00:00 | |
Lukc | *saying, btw :/ | 00:00 |
---|---|---|
*** bjorn2in_ has joined #freeorion | 00:15 | |
*** bjorn2in_ has quit IRC | 00:19 | |
*** bjorn2in_ has joined #freeorion | 00:35 | |
*** bjorn2in has quit IRC | 00:39 | |
*** bjorn2in_ has quit IRC | 00:41 | |
*** bjorn2in has joined #freeorion | 00:51 | |
*** Lukc has quit IRC | 01:05 | |
*** bjorn2in has quit IRC | 01:15 | |
*** bjorn2in has joined #freeorion | 01:15 | |
*** VargaD has quit IRC | 01:22 | |
STalKer-Y | ^^ | 01:57 |
*** STalKer-Y has quit IRC | 04:07 | |
*** STalKer-X has joined #freeorion | 04:18 | |
*** StrangerDanger has quit IRC | 04:19 | |
*** tmass has quit IRC | 06:15 | |
*** VargaD has joined #freeorion | 07:09 | |
*** Lukc has joined #freeorion | 08:14 | |
*** StrangerDanger has joined #freeorion | 08:17 | |
*** StrangerDanger has quit IRC | 08:34 | |
*** StrangerDanger has joined #freeorion | 08:42 | |
Lukc | Hi. | 09:11 |
Lukc | main() caught exception(std::exception): OGRE EXCEPTION(7:InternalErrorException): Could not load dynamic library libGiGiOgrePlugin_OIS.so. System Error: libGiGiOgrePlugin_OIS.so: cannot open shared object file: No such file or directory in DynLib::load at OgreDynLib.cpp (line 81) | 09:12 |
Lukc | However… I did build GiGi without OIS support. | 09:12 |
Lukc | Well, I have build everything without OIS support, because OIS was just not installed. | 09:13 |
Lukc | So, I don’t really understand why the hell freeorion (OGRE?) is asking OIS. :/ | 09:13 |
Lukc | Besides, if I try to recompile everything with OIS support… GiGi does not build. | 11:45 |
*** StrangerDanger has quit IRC | 14:41 | |
*** tmass has joined #freeorion | 16:02 | |
*** dansan has quit IRC | 17:03 | |
*** dansan has joined #freeorion | 17:05 | |
*** bookwar1 has quit IRC | 18:22 | |
*** bookwar has joined #freeorion | 18:37 | |
*** bookwar1 has joined #freeorion | 18:41 | |
*** bookwar has quit IRC | 18:41 | |
*** neoneurone has joined #freeorion | 18:58 | |
*** neoneurone has quit IRC | 19:41 | |
*** Lukc has quit IRC | 20:09 | |
*** dansan_ has joined #freeorion | 21:10 | |
*** dansan has quit IRC | 21:11 | |
*** tmass has quit IRC | 21:17 | |
*** bjorn2in has quit IRC | 21:17 | |
*** planetmaker has quit IRC | 21:17 | |
*** eristikophiles has quit IRC | 21:17 | |
*** tmass has joined #freeorion | 21:18 | |
*** bjorn2in has joined #freeorion | 21:18 | |
*** planetmaker has joined #freeorion | 21:18 | |
*** eristikophiles has joined #freeorion | 21:18 | |
*** Lukc has joined #freeorion | 21:23 | |
GeofftheMedio | Lukc: FreeOrion needs GiGi built with OIS | 21:23 |
Lukc | Damn. :( | 21:24 |
Lukc | I must have read the wiki page a little to fast, then. | 21:24 |
Lukc | GeofftheMedio, still, that’s strange that FreeOrion has been built, then. | 21:24 |
Lukc | (it’s strange for me) | 21:24 |
GeofftheMedio | GiGiOIS is a plugin for FreeOrion | 21:28 |
GeofftheMedio | so not linked against the .lib at build time | 21:28 |
GeofftheMedio | as far as I recall | 21:28 |
Lukc | Ok. | 21:29 |
GeofftheMedio | but it is still needed to run FreeOrion | 21:29 |
Lukc | Ok. | 21:29 |
Lukc | I have a suggestion, then. | 21:29 |
Lukc | Could you add a message saying it somewhere, if GiGi does not have OIS support? \o/ | 21:30 |
GeofftheMedio | GiGi itself is independent of OIS | 21:30 |
GeofftheMedio | GiGiOIS is another library that's built if you configure the GiGi build to do so | 21:31 |
GeofftheMedio | so... no | 21:31 |
Lukc | Ok. | 21:31 |
Lukc | Then could you add a message saying it somewher, if GiGiOIS is not found? | 21:31 |
GeofftheMedio | there is one: when you try to run FreeOrion without it being present | 21:32 |
Lukc | Well, or at least say it in the wiki page. | 21:32 |
Lukc | It’s not really helpful, you know… | 21:32 |
Lukc | I understood it as “you don’t have some library you should not have”. | 21:32 |
GeofftheMedio | what is "it" ? | 21:33 |
Lukc | The message. | 21:33 |
Lukc | The one you got when you run FreeOrion without GiGiOIS. | 21:33 |
GeofftheMedio | That depends on your OS or build system, I suspect | 21:33 |
GeofftheMedio | it wouldn't complain about you not having a library you don't need; that doesn't make sense... | 21:34 |
Lukc | Yes, that’s exactly what I thought! | 21:34 |
GeofftheMedio | so... what's the confusion then? | 21:34 |
Lukc | That I thought OIS support in GiGi was not required. | 21:35 |
GeofftheMedio | about the message | 21:35 |
GeofftheMedio | it was complaining that you didn't have a library | 21:35 |
Lukc | Yes. It was complaining that I didn’t have a library that I thought optional. | 21:35 |
GeofftheMedio | from which you apparently concluded that you did not need the library, and it was complaining for no reason | 21:35 |
Lukc | No, I thought that before. | 21:35 |
Lukc | I… uh… | 21:35 |
Lukc | Well. Don’t bother. | 21:35 |
GeofftheMedio | I can't change that message regardless | 21:36 |
GeofftheMedio | there could be some changes to the compile or other wiki pages if you can suggest something specific | 21:36 |
Lukc | Yes. On the Linux/Unix/whatever compile page, I suggest saying what GiGi needs to support. | 21:37 |
Lukc | And maybe even modifying the cmake command that is given, to easy copy&paste. | 21:38 |
GeofftheMedio | http://freeorion.org/index.php?title=Compile&curid=638&diff=8465&oldid=8450 | 21:39 |
tpb | <http://ln-s.net/9hBl> (at freeorion.org) | 21:40 |
Lukc | Yep. | 21:40 |
Lukc | But on the particular Linux page it’d be great too. | 21:41 |
GeofftheMedio | I don't know the linux build system / process well enough to make such changes | 21:41 |
Lukc | You mean… You’re not one of us ? :o | 21:42 |
Lukc | How is that possible? | 21:42 |
Lukc | I miracly successfully run FreeOrion. \o/ | 21:43 |
Lukc | Hum, the Linux page. | 21:43 |
Lukc | Well, basically, you should tell that GiGi must be built with OIS and Ogre support in the GiGi section of the page. | 21:44 |
Lukc | -DBUILD_OGRE_DRIVER=ON -DBUILD_OGRE_OIS_PLUGIN=ON should be added before the "." in the line containing "cmake" | 21:45 |
Lukc | And that should be all. | 21:45 |
GeofftheMedio | line in what? | 21:46 |
Lukc | In what what? There in a set of commands to give to your shell to build GiGi. One of them begins by "cmake". | 21:46 |
Lukc | In the Linux compile page. | 21:46 |
Lukc | Yeah, I know, you won’t edit anyway because you won’t understand. :/ | 21:47 |
Lukc | Seems I can’t write in the game. :/ | 21:48 |
Lukc | Strange, now I can. | 21:49 |
GeofftheMedio | http://freeorion.org/index.php?title=Compile_In_Linux&curid=1162&diff=8466&oldid=8346 | 21:49 |
tpb | <http://ln-s.net/9hC4> (at freeorion.org) | 21:49 |
GeofftheMedio | OIS isn't very good | 21:49 |
Lukc | It’s a shame I’m not involved. Usually I’m the guy who finds more bugs than anything else… :/ | 21:49 |
Lukc | I dunno. I never heard of it before yesterday. | 21:50 |
Lukc | Seems right. :) | 21:50 |
Lukc | Is the rotating thing around the selected planet recent? | 21:52 |
GeofftheMedio | planet, or star? | 21:53 |
Lukc | Star. | 21:53 |
GeofftheMedio | a few months | 21:53 |
Lukc | I find it quiet annoying. :/ | 21:54 |
GeofftheMedio | replace the graphics for it with an empty / all transparent png | 21:56 |
GeofftheMedio | or add an option to disable it, and post a patch | 21:56 |
Lukc | Ahah. I’d like to. However, I’m not very experienced in C++, and a patch may take time. | 21:59 |
Lukc | If I ever manage to have a Pkgfile for FreeOrion I’ll already be happy… | 22:00 |
Lukc | Is it normal that the tech and prod panels are not on the right side of the game window? | 22:02 |
GeofftheMedio | not sure what you mean, but it might be due to resizing the FreeOrion window | 22:03 |
GeofftheMedio | exit and restart for some of the layout to update | 22:03 |
Lukc | Ok. | 22:04 |
Lukc | Well, everything resizes, except tech, prod and design. :/ | 22:04 |
GeofftheMedio | as I said, "some of the layout" | 22:05 |
Lukc | Ah. | 22:06 |
Lukc | So, this is the "rest" of the layout? | 22:06 |
GeofftheMedio | ? | 22:07 |
Lukc | Don’t bother. | 22:12 |
*** Lukc has quit IRC | 23:53 |
Generated by irclog2html.py 2.5 by Marius Gedminas - find it at mg.pov.lt!